Summation and discrimination of gratings moving in opposite directions.
TL;DR: The small amount of summation observed at low spatial and high temporal frequencies is approximately consistent with the action of direction-selective mechanisms, as proposed by Levinson and Sekuler (1975) , provided that probability summation between such mechanisms is taken into account.

Adaptation to a "spatial-frequency doubled" stimulus.
Peter Thompson,Brian J. Murphy +1 more
TL;DR: The results suggest that spatial-frequency elevation occurs later in the visual system than adaptation or that these two processes are independent of one another, at least under the conditions of these experiments.
